LDK expects its MPs to vote ratification of the agreement on demarcation (RTKlive)

By   /  31/08/2016  /  No Comments

    Print       Email

The leadership of the Democratic League of Kosovo discussed at its meeting today the agreement for the demarcation of the border line between Kosovo and Montenegro.

They reconfirmed the unanimous support of LDK structures for LDK MPs who would vote for the ratification of the agreement, approved by local and international experts and strongly supported by the United States of America and other European partner countries, says a press release issued by this party.

“By voting the ratification of the agreement, LDK MPs contribute directly to the defense of state interests, liberalization of visas, strengthening Kosovo’s statehood and sovereignty, partnership with the U.S. and transformation of KSF into Armed Force,” notes the press release further adding that ratification of the agreement is an international obligation that has to be fulfilled. “All other alternatives serve to harmful scenarios for the citizens of Kosovo and its statehood.”
